Have you tried any plant-based food lately? If so, you're not the only one! A lot of meat-eaters are attempting a 'flexitarian' diet or a Meatless Monday to minimize their consumption of meat and dairy. Business Insider reports that plant-based food sales have grown 11% this past year, and it's not just vegans and vegetarians; meat-eaters are helping with those sales. Some markets have embraced items like the Beyond Burger and Impossible Burger. Both brands mimic the texture and flavor of beef.

I've had a few plant-based burgers before, and I will say, they're pretty good. However, if you do decide you want to try one just to say you did it, you do have to do it with an open mind. They're not going to taste exactly like the real thing, but they're pretty close. Flexitarians are the biggest part of market growth. If you didn't know, that's someone who is trying to minimize their meat and dairy intake. Business Insider reports that in 2019, the industry hit $5 billion and a recent report predicted that the market could be worth $74.2 billion by the year 2027.
